The specialty coffee industry is evolving rapidly, driven by changing consumer expectations and operational challenges. Coffee shop owners are increasingly looking to technology to help meet quality demands while managing their businesses effectively. Automation can enhance efficiency, but it cannot replace the essential need for skilled baristas. Conversations with experts reveal that baristas now require extensive knowledge and skills, resembling the role of a sommelier. However, the industry faces significant staffing issues, with high turnover rates and a lack of skilled workers.
• The role of the barista has expanded, requiring deep knowledge of coffee and customer service.
• Many coffee shops struggle with staffing due to high turnover and changing workforce priorities.
• Automation, like the WMF espresso NEXT, can support baristas without replacing them.
• Effective training and technology integration are key to maintaining quality and efficiency.
Finding the right balance between human expertise and automation is crucial for coffee shops to thrive. Embracing technology can help address staffing challenges while ensuring high-quality coffee experiences for customers.
